Choosing a water purifier that removes fluoride

Only a few purifier technologies reduce fluoride, and the ones most households already own are not among them. Reverse osmosis, activated alumina, bone char and distillation are the realistic options; ordinary carbon pitchers, faucet filters and refrigerator cartridges pass fluoride through essentially untouched, whatever the packaging implies.

Reverse osmosis, the usual answer

A reverse osmosis unit pushes water through a semipermeable membrane that rejects the great majority of dissolved ions, fluoride among them, and sends what it rejects to drain. It is the most widely available option, it sits under a sink or on a counter, and it handles a long list of other dissolved contaminants at the same time. The tradeoffs are a drain connection, reject water, slow production into a small storage tank, and membranes and prefilters that have to be replaced on schedule.

Activated alumina and bone char

Activated alumina is a specialist adsorbent media that binds fluoride, and it is the technology behind most cartridges that are honestly labeled as fluoride reduction filters. Bone char carbon works similarly and appears in gravity units. Both are consumable: capacity is finite and performance falls as the media loads, without any change in taste or flow to warn you. Both also work better in a particular pH range, so they are more predictable in a cartridge sized for known water than as a universal add on.

Distillation, and what does not work

A countertop distiller boils water and condenses the vapor, leaving fluoride and other dissolved solids in the boiling chamber. It is slow, uses electricity and needs descaling, but it is technologically simple and does not depend on media capacity. What does not work is the equipment most people already have: standard carbon pitchers, faucet mounted carbon filters, refrigerator cartridges, sediment filters, ultraviolet lamps and water softeners all leave fluoride in the water.

Verify the claim, do not trust the word purifier

Purifier is a marketing word with no fixed technical meaning, so the useful check is a certification listing against the relevant standard for the specific claim. Look for fluoride reduction named explicitly in the manufacturer's performance data sheet, along with the capacity in gallons at which that reduction was verified, then match that capacity to your household use. A general statement that a unit removes contaminants is not a fluoride claim, and a fluoride claim with no rated capacity is not a useful one.

Decide what you are actually treating

Fluoride in a community supply is added and reported, and the EPA requires every community water system to publish an annual consumer confidence report, with a finder maintained by the agency, so you can read your own figure before buying anything. Well owners have naturally occurring fluoride instead and need a lab test, since nobody reports it for them. Questions people ask about water purifier that removes fluoride

Do carbon filters remove fluoride?

Standard activated carbon does not. Carbon targets chlorine, taste, odor and some organic chemicals, and fluoride passes through it. Bone char carbon is the exception and is a specifically different media.

Does boiling water remove fluoride?

No, boiling concentrates it, because water leaves as vapor and fluoride stays behind. Distillation works only because the vapor is captured and condensed while the residue is discarded.

Is reverse osmosis or activated alumina the better choice?

Reverse osmosis handles fluoride plus a broad range of dissolved contaminants and needs a drain. Activated alumina is a simpler cartridge aimed at fluoride specifically and suits homes where a drain connection is not practical.

How do I find out how much fluoride is in my water?

On a community supply, read the annual consumer confidence report your utility publishes, which the EPA helps you locate. On a private well the fluoride is naturally occurring and only a lab test will tell you.
